While the Continue button takes you to the next unanswered question, the Review button takes you to the next relevant question in sequence whether answered or not.

To toggle between Continue and Review, click the arrow to the right of the Continue/Review button and select the desired mode. |
Here are simple rules on when to use Continue and when to use Review:
The Continue mode is the program default and it is the best way to move through the Q&A in order to create a document for the first time. It takes you to unanswered relevant questions based on your prior answers. (You can also press Ctrl+Down Arrow on your keyboard to execute the Continue function.)
The Review mode is sometimes used once you have answered all of the questions and want to go back to the answer file at a later time to either review or change your answers. You do NOT have start at Question #1 to use Review. You can click on any question in the Navigator and then switch to Review mode but remember to switch back to the Continue mode f you want to send the document to the word processor. Keep in mind that using the Review mode is optional, i.e. you do NOT have to use Review to change your answers. Rather, you can click any question in the Navigator to change your answer.

Important! If you are in Review mode and land on a Repeat Control Question, and want to Add an answer at that question, you need to temporarily switch back to the Continue mode first, add your answer and then switch back to Review mode to continue reviewing your answers. |
